Transaction 84af02e9cae1dc0513e4e46dec80d2ffa5dfddbeaa8651330b09fbbae66bfaa8
1 Input
1 Output
-
84af02e9cae1dc0513e4e46dec80d2ffa5dfddbeaa8651330b09fbbae66bfaa8:0
- value
- 265425559
- script pubkey
- OP_0 OP_PUSHBYTES_20 05672cece21dfc2e9005c7e13e76af7671e529ea
- address
- bc1qq4njem8zrh7zayq9clsnua40wec72202xk33rq